We bought Annual Passes this past June when we made our first trip home! Seeing as how we have until June 2006 to use our passes again, we are planning to go back home again before June arrives.


Question is, when is the best time to go. November, December and January are out because we have a newborne (October baby) who would not be up to the flying and all the activity. We were thinking about some time between February and May. I know April gets bad because of Easter, but what about the other times?

I HATE crowds. Is February to cold to swim, etc.?

I remember seeing a link to another page which had details about the crowd levels for each month (maybe even each week, I forget). Can anyone help me plan when to go.

Feb. is usually too chilly for swimming, May is a nice time to go. Early May would be best IMHO. Have fun!
 
We we've been there in January & February and it was wonderful... you could just walk on to the rides! My DS did RR 11 times in a row in less than 1 hour! The weather was fine during the day. A little cool at night but we did fine in sweatshirts and light jackets. It was warm enough to swim mid day... most of the days.

BUT in February we also hit what we refer to as "Black Monday" which was the day after the Daytona 500!!! OMG! It was busier than Christmas!! And I'm not sure how long those people stayed because it was our last day. But every other day of the week was wonderful. (That year the race was on Feb 15th, we were there from the 7th on.)

We've also been in mid April which wasn't that bad... the Spring break crowds are worse in March. But if I had to go again I would probably go the end of April or early May... I've heard that is a great time.

We went last year the first week of February and we were COLD! Okay, it's all relative. I know those of you from the snow were probably wearing shorts. The crowds were great. Very little lines.

I just couldn't handle the cold rain. Blah!
